JJ Parma discusses the integration of AI in school safety systems and the challenges of weapon detection technology.

Summary In this episode of AI in Action, hosts Maurie and Jim Beasley welcome JJ Parma from Zero Eyes, a company focused on AI-driven weapon detection technology. JJ shares his journey from a Navy SEAL to his current role, discussing the importance of integrating AI in school safety systems. The conversation delves into the challenges of false positives, the role of human verification in AI detection, and the impact of media representation on public perception. The episode emphasizes the need for a balanced approach to technology in schools, ensuring safety without compromising the educational environment. Takeaways JJ Parma is a retired Navy SEAL who now works in AI weapon detection. Zero Eyes aims to implement AI technology in schools for safety. The technology focuses on detecting brandished firearms only. Human verification is crucial to reduce false positives in AI detection. Media representation can misinterpret incidents involving AI technology. Schools need to balance safety measures with a non-prison-like environment.
